Kerala patient discharged

A male patient, who arrived from Wuhan and later tested positive for coronaviru­s, has been discharged after two tests came negative, Kerala Health Minister K.K. Shailaja’s office said yesterday. The patient, quarantine­d at the Alappuzha Medical College, was the second person who had showed up positive in the test. He will be under observatio­n at his house, the statement said. All the three patients — a female and two males — who were tested coronaviru­s positive were studying in Wuhan. According to the minister’s office, 2,397 people are under observatio­n at their homes and 22 are in hospitals.
